2022 Toyota Tundra's Interior Will Have a Larger Screen

  • Toyota has revealed an image of the 2022 Tundra's interior.

  • It shows a large center mounted touchscreen, which will help it compete against the Ford F-150 and Ram 1500, which both have available 12.0-inch screens.

  • Toyota showed an image of a TRD Pro model last week, and the full truck will debut in the coming months.

If Toyota wants its new Tundra full-size pickup to compete with trucks from Ford and Ram it'll need to have a significantly improved interior. A large central touchscreen is crucial, and Toyota is showing from this teaser photo of the new truck's interior that it's serious about making it stand out.

This teaser photo shows the top of the new Tundra's dash, and it seems to be the same TRD Pro model that Toyota revealed last week. Two JBL speakers are mounted inside the A pillars, and the steering wheel has a red strip atop the steering wheel, likely exclusive to the TRD Pro model. The main attraction is the large center-mounted touchscreen, which has Apple CarPlay displayed in this photo.

The current Tundra comes standard with a 7.0-inch touchscreen, though an 8.0-inch unit is available. The new truck's will be much larger so it can compete with the Ford F-150 and Ram 1500's available 12.0-inch screens. A smaller screen will likely be standard on the new Tundra.

Look for more information on the 2022 Tundra in the coming months, and we expect Toyota to drop a few more bits of information before its official debut this year.
